📖 Full Retelling

Macquarie Group, a leading global financial services firm, has revised its outlook for Chinese e-commerce giant Alibaba Group Holding Ltd., lowering its price target for the company's stock. The adjustment, announced by the firm's analysts, is a direct response to the significant and ongoing investments Alibaba is making in artificial intelligence (AI) infrastructure and research. This strategic move by Macquarie reflects growing investor caution about the near-term financial impact of these heavy capital expenditures on Alibaba's profitability, even as the company positions itself for future technological competition. The decision underscores a critical tension in the tech sector between aggressive investment in next-generation technologies and maintaining shareholder returns. Alibaba, like its global peers, is engaged in a costly race to develop and deploy advanced AI models and cloud computing capabilities. These investments are essential for maintaining competitiveness in areas like cloud services, e-commerce personalization, and autonomous systems. However, they also compress operating margins and delay earnings growth, leading financial analysts to reassess short-to-medium term valuation models. Macquarie's revised target signals a broader analytical trend of scrutinizing the balance between growth spending and financial performance. While the long-term potential of AI is widely acknowledged, the immediate financial burden is becoming a key metric for investors. This analysis will likely influence market sentiment towards Alibaba and other tech firms making similar large-scale bets, as the industry navigates a period of high investment with uncertain immediate payoffs.
